My Exchange group will not enable proactive or background scanning due to the
increase of the load on our Exchange environment and the fact that McAffee
has recommended against enabling it in GroupShield.

Is there a way for me to force unread/non-accessed messages to synch/push to
my Motorola Q (WM5) without enabling proactive or background scanning?

I currently have a spare PC setup with OL2K3 in Cached Exchange mode. It
seems to at least enable me to access the messages, but I have to set the
phone to synch once every 5 minutes because I don't get the "direct push"
functionality. The Exchange team will not "support" non blackberry devices
but they are open to suggestions that don't involve increasing the server's
load or preventing messages from going directly into the Message Store. They
are running exch 2k3 SP2.

Well... not sure what the problem is, but we did notice that the
msExchMailboxSecurityDescriptor for people having issues was massive long
with dupes and everything. We corrected by having the user export all the
mail to a pst. Deleted exchange attributes from user account. puged the
mailbox and then mail-enabled the user with a new mailbox. User then
imported all the emails from the pst.

After doing this, the msExchMailboxSecurityDescriptor looks like this:

O:<SID>G:<SID>D:(A;CI;CCDCRC;;;PS)

where <SID> is the sid of the person who created the mailbox.

one line. that's it. As long as that was the only entry, it worked fine.
The minute we changed mailbox permissions or moved the mailbox to another
store, it added all the rest of the ACLs from the message store and
DirectPush didn't work anymore.
